电子表格excel表格中如何将6列表格合并成一列表格?
1.excel表格中如何将6列表格合并成一列表格?
合并,G1输入
=text(A1,"00")&" "&text(B1,"00")&" "&text(C1,"00")&" "&text(D1,"00")&" "&text(E1,"00")&" "&text(F1,"00")
03出现的次数
=count(find("03",G1:G100))
----------------
count就行啊,因为你这个彩票号码不可能一期出现两个03,你在C1单元格输入
=count(find(text(row(),"00"),B$2:B$1000))
crtl+shift+enter结束公式,向下填充,第几行就是哪个号码出现的次数
2.如何把Excel表格的多列数据合并
把Excel表格的多列数据合并的方法:
以下图为例,现需将表格红色边框内的多列内容,合并在右侧枚红色边框的一列。
1.在F2表格内输入“=”。
2.输入完可以得到这样的效果。
3.逐步在F3输入“=B3&C3&D3&E3”,F4输入“=B4&C24&D4&E4”……可以得到相应效果。
4.还有简便的方式:拖拽格式,得到效果。选中表格,拖拽右下角的“+”往下拖拽即可。
3.excel怎么吧多列合并到一列
比如A列为空白列,是为合并后结果准备的,
B列开始有若干列及行数据,(假设不超过100行)
用vba方法如下:
在工作表界面作如下操作:
按Alt+F11->;打开vixual basic编辑器
在打开的vixual basic编辑器窗口作如下操作:
标题栏->;视图->;工程资源管理器(单击打开)
双击sheet1(注意你的工作表如果是sheet2,就双击sheet2)
右边出现一大片空白区域
将下述代码复制->;粘贴进去:
Sub 多列合并()
Dim i As Integer, j As Integer, n As Integer
n = 0
For i = 1 To 100 Step 1
If Cells(i, 2) = "" And Cells(i + 1, 2) = "" Then Exit For
For j = 2 To 200 Step 1
If Cells(i, j) = "" Then Exit For
n = n + 1
Cells(n, 1) = Cells(i, j)
Next j
Next i
End Sub
'运行即可
呵呵,仔细阅读了一下问题,发现上述代码运行结果不是你想要的,应该一列一列提取:
代码更改如下:
Sub 多列合并()
Dim i As Integer, j As Integer, n As Integer
n = 0
For j = 2 To 200 Step 1
If Cells(1, j) = "" And Cells(1, j + 1) = "" Then Exit For
For i = 1 To 100 Step 1
If Cells(i, j) = "" Then Exit For
n = n + 1
Cells(n, 1) = Cells(i, j)
Next i
Next j
End Sub
'运行即可,我试过了,正确的!
